随着区块链技术的不断发展和加密货币的普及,如何安全地存储和管理数字资产成为了越来越多投资者关注的焦点。多重签名(Multisignature)技术作为一种有效的数字资产保护方式,正受到越来越广泛的重视。本文将全面解析区块链钱包中的多重签名技术,包括其原理、优势、应用场景以及实施步骤。此外,我们还将探讨与多重签名相关的常见问题,为用户提供全面的参考。
什么是多重签名?
多重签名(Multisignature)是一种安全协议,允许多个密钥进行交易确认。这种技术通常用于区块链钱包,增加了数字资产的安全性。在传统的单一签名钱包中,钱包的所有权和交易的控制权仅归单个私钥所有,这意味着一旦私钥泄露,整个钱包的资产可能会面临风险。而多重签名钱包的出现,则是通过要求多个密钥共同签名来完成交易,提高了资产的安全性。
例如,一个典型的多重签名钱包可以设定为“2-of-3”的模式,即需要三个私钥中的两个进行交易授权。这意味着即使一个私钥被窃取,黑客仍然无法单独完成交易。只有在拥有两个有效钥匙的情况下,才能执行相关的交易操作。这样的设置显著提高了资金的安全性。
多重签名的优势
多重签名为区块链钱包带来了众多优势,主要体现在以下几个方面:
- 增强安全性: 多重签名为用户提供了一层额外的安全保护,相较于单一签名,其安全性要强得多。
- 防止私钥丢失: 在使用多重签名时,如果一个私钥丢失,用户仍然可以使用其他私钥完成交易。这样的设计有效降低了因单一私钥丢失引起的资产损失风险。
- 集体决策: 对于团队或公司运营的加密货币钱包,可以设置多重签名规则,确保每笔交易需经过多方授权,促进集体决策。
- 抵抗恶意攻击: 即使有人试图非法获取单一私钥,也无法轻易控制钱包或转换资产,从而提升整体的财务保护水平。
多重签名的应用场景
多重签名不仅适用于个人用户,也广泛应用于企业、交易所和各种基于区块链的服务。在以下几个应用场景中,多重签名的优势得到了充分的体现:
- 企业钱包: 企业在管理资金时通常需要更高的安全性,通过多重签名,多个管理层成员可以共同决定资金的使用和转移,降低错误或滥用资金的风险。
- 代币销售/ICO: 在筹款期间,采用多重签名来管理和分配筹集的资金,确保防止因单一角色的失误导致资金损失。
- 交易所安全: 许多加密货币交易所使用多重签名技术防止盗窃,确保用户资产的安全。通过设定严格的签名规则,可以提升交易所的安全性,减少黑客攻击的风险。
如何实现多重签名钱包?
实现多重签名钱包远比单一签名钱包复杂,需要一些技术知识和步骤。一般而言,实现多重签名钱包的步骤如下:
- 选择支持多重签名的钱包: 选择一个支持多重签名的数字钱包,确保它能够兼容所需的多重签名格式。
- 定义规则: 在创建钱包时,设定多重签名的规则,例如“2-of-3”,这指明进行交易需要几把钥匙进行确认。
- 生成密钥对: 为每个需要的参与者生成私钥和相应的公钥,确保所有参与者都妥善保管自己的私钥。
- 进行资金管理: 在多重签名钱包中转入资金后,所有交易都需要符合同样的多重签名规则,确保参与者在进行资金管理时都是透明和安全的。
相关常见问题
1. 多重签名钱包适合哪些用户使用?
多重签名钱包适合多种类型的用户使用。在家庭理财方面,很多家庭成员共同持有资产,为了管理和控制,如果发生错误或突发状况,可以通过设定的多重规则来保护家庭财富。而在企业方面,公司为了防范内部或外部的财务风险,通常会选择使用多重签名钱包,以避免因单一人的决策而导致资金损失。此外,一些加密货币交易所也会采用多重签名技术来提高资产的安全性,保护用户的资金,防止恶意攻击和盗窃事件的发生。
2. 如何选择合适的多重签名钱包?
选择合适的多重签名钱包需要考虑几个关键因素:
- 安全性: 首先要关注钱包的安全性,确保其采用先进的加密技术和防护措施。查看钱包的背景、公司信誉、用户评价等信息。
- 功能: 根据个人需求选择功能更完备的钱包,例如是否支持多种加密资产、是否容易操作等。
- 费用:选择相对合理的费用和交易费用,避免因钱包使用过多额外费用而影响整体收益。
- 易用性: 使用多重签名钱包时,不同参与者的使用便捷性、防止操作错位等方面也需考虑,选择界面友好、易于理解的钱包。
3. 多重签名钱包的缺点是什么?
虽然多重签名钱包提供了更高的安全性,但它们也存在一些潜在的缺点:
- 管理复杂: 多重签名钱包要求用户妥善管理多个私钥,这在一定程度上增加了管理的复杂性。在一些情况下,如密钥丢失、参与者变动可能引发操作困难。
- 交易延时: 需要多个参与者签名的情况下,交易时间可能会更长,特别是在需要协调的场合,延误可能对资产流动造成影响。
- 技术门槛: 理解和运用多重签名技术需要一定的技术知识,对于初学者来说,接受和掌握这些技术可能相对困难。
4. 如果丢失多重签名中的一个私钥,怎么办?
如果丢失多重签名中的一个私钥,实际上取决于你的多重签名规则:
- 2-of-3签名: 如果设定为2-of-3的规则,只需两把钥匙授权就可以完成交易。这样,即使丢失一把钥匙,你仍然能够进行操作。
- 1-of-3签名: 若设定为此类规则,丢失一把钥匙后可能引发一些问题。如果丢失的密钥是唯一的签名密钥,并且你没有其他备份的话,那么你甚至可能无法访问你的资产。
因此,建议用户在创建多重签名钱包时,妥善记录和保管相关的私钥,并事先设置备份和恢复机制,以防万一。在规划时也应考虑多样化的密钥管理方案,以确保在发生突发状况时能有效应对。
综上所述,多重签名技术在确保区块链钱包安全性方面发挥了至关重要的作用。通过合理应用此技术,用户能更好地保护他们的数字资产,同时降低免遭潜在风险。不过用户也要了解其管理的复杂性,选择合适的工具和方法,确保在使用过程中能够得到顺畅的体验。